West sits in United States. In 2024 it voted Democratic.

Across the recorded series it reached a Democratic high of 34.3 points in 1936 and a Republican high of 37.1 points in 1924. Between 2020 and 2024 the region moved 6.5 points toward the Republican candidate; the 2024 margin was 10.2 points.

A population of 79,110,410, a 52% non-Hispanic-white share, and a median household income of $95,174 describe the region.

How did West, United States vote in 2024?
In 2024, West, United States voted Democratic by 10.2 points (D+10.2), carried by the Democratic candidate. Out of 35,157,726 votes cast, 18,846,838 went Democratic and 15,264,051 went Republican.

When did West, United States last vote Republican?
The most recent presidential election in which West, United States voted Republican was 1988.
How many people live in West, United States?
West, United States has a population of 79,110,410 according to the 2024 American Community Survey 5-year estimates from the US Census Bureau.
What is the median household income in West, United States?
Median household income in West, United States is $95,174 — above the national median of $80,734. The United States state median is $92,788.
